Field staff must review job-specific workplan and coordinate with project manager to verify that all up front logistics are completed prior to starting work including,but not limited to,permitting,access
<br /> agreements, and notification to required contacts(e.g. site managers, inspectors, clients, subcontractors, etc.). A tailgate safety meeting must be performed and documented at the beginning of each
<br /> workday. Plan,Prevent,Execute LPPE2 procedures must be used throw hout the pro'ect. Weather conditions(heat,cold,rain,lightning)must also be considered.
